
Agent AI dla systemu plików MCP
Zintegruj bezpieczny, oparty na protokole dostęp do lokalnych plików i katalogów z serwerem systemu plików MCP. Umożliwiaj płynnie zautomatyzowane operacje na plikach, szczegółowe wyszukiwanie i zarządzanie katalogami — wszystko przy zapewnieniu solidnego bezpieczeństwa, walidacji ścieżek oraz sprawnej integracji z aplikacjami zgodnymi z Model Context Protocol (MCP).

Kompleksowe operacje na plikach i katalogach
Wzmacniaj swoje przepływy pracy pełnym zestawem bezpiecznych operacji na plikach i katalogach. Czytaj, zapisuj, kopiuj, przenoś i usuwaj pliki z precyzją. Zarządzaj katalogami, pobieraj listy i wizualizuj struktury hierarchiczne — wszystko poprzez interfejs oparty na protokole.
- Odczyt i edycja plików.
- Bezpiecznie odczytuj, modyfikuj i zapisuj pliki lub katalogi z zaawansowaną walidacją i kontrolą dostępu.
- Zarządzanie katalogami.
- Twórz, listuj i nawiguj po katalogach, z obsługą szczegółowych i hierarchicznych widoków.
- Operacje kopiowania i przenoszenia.
- Łatwo kopiuj, przenoś lub zmieniaj nazwy plików i katalogów z operacjami atomowymi i obsługą błędów.
- Bezpieczne usuwanie.
- Usuwaj pliki lub katalogi bezpiecznie, z opcjonalnym kasowaniem rekurencyjnym i obsługą symlinków.

Zaawansowane wyszukiwanie i metadane
Szybko lokalizuj pliki i katalogi za pomocą rekurencyjnego wyszukiwania, dopasowywania wzorców oraz zapytań do zawartości plików. Pobieraj szczegółowe metadane i korzystaj z wbudowanego rozpoznawania typu MIME dla inteligentniejszej automatyzacji.
- Rekurencyjne wyszukiwanie.
- Wyszukuj pliki i katalogi według wzorca lub wewnątrz zawartości plików w całych drzewach katalogów.
- Wgląd w metadane.
- Pobieraj metadane plików i katalogów na potrzeby szczegółowych ścieżek audytu i automatyzacji.
- Rozpoznawanie typu MIME.
- Automatycznie wykrywaj i przetwarzaj typy plików, obsługując formaty tekstowe, binarne i obrazów.

Bezpieczeństwo i integracja klasy korporacyjnej
Wykorzystaj solidne funkcje bezpieczeństwa, takie jak walidacja ścieżek, ochrona symlinków, kontrola dostępu do katalogów i limity rozmiarów. Integruj się płynnie z Dockerem, Go i aplikacjami MCP, aby usprawnić rozwój i zapewnić zgodność.
- Bezpieczny dostęp do katalogów.
- Ogranicz dostęp serwera tylko do dozwolonych katalogów i zapobiegaj nieautoryzowanemu przemieszczaniu się po strukturze.
- Gotowość Go i Docker.
- Uruchamiaj jako samodzielny serwer, bibliotekę Go lub kontener Docker dla maksymalnej elastyczności.
- Integracja z protokołem MCP.
- Płynnie integruj się z aplikacjami opartymi na Model Context Protocol, aby zautomatyzować przepływy pracy.
INTEGRACJA MCP
Dostępne narzędzia integracji systemu plików MCP
Następujące narzędzia są dostępne w ramach integracji systemu plików MCP:
- read_file
Odczytaj pełną zawartość pliku z systemu plików podając jego ścieżkę.
- read_multiple_files
Odczytaj zawartość wielu plików w jednej operacji, podając listę ścieżek do plików.
- write_file
Utwórz nowy plik lub nadpisz istniejący nową treścią podaną pod wskazaną ścieżką.
- modify_file
Zaktualizuj plik wyszukując i zamieniając tekst przy użyciu dopasowania ciągów lub wyrażeń regularnych.
- create_directory
Utwórz nowy katalog lub upewnij się, że katalog istnieje pod wskazaną ścieżką.
- delete_file
Usuń plik lub katalog z systemu plików, z opcjonalnym usuwaniem rekurencyjnym.
- list_directory
Uzyskaj szczegółową listę wszystkich plików i katalogów w podanej ścieżce.
- search_files
Rekurencyjnie wyszukuj pliki i katalogi pasujące do wzorca, zaczynając od podanej ścieżki.
- search_within_files
Wyszukuj tekst w zawartości plików w drzewach katalogów, z obsługą różnych filtrów.
- get_file_info
Pobierz szczegółowe metadane o pliku lub katalogu pod wskazaną ścieżką.
- list_allowed_directories
Zwraca listę katalogów, do których ten serwer ma uprawnienia dostępu.
- tree
Zwraca hierarchiczną reprezentację JSON struktury katalogów z konfigurowalną głębokością.
- copy_file
Kopiuj pliki i katalogi ze ścieżki źródłowej do docelowej.
- move_file
Przenieś lub zmień nazwę plików i katalogów między podanymi ścieżkami źródłowymi i docelowymi.
Bezpieczny, elastyczny dostęp do systemu plików z MCP
Doświadcz płynnego i bezpiecznego dostępu do lokalnych plików i katalogów przez Model Context Protocol (MCP). Rozwijaj swoje aplikacje o zaawansowane operacje na plikach, solidne zarządzanie katalogami i zaawansowane wyszukiwanie — wszystko z bezpieczeństwem klasy korporacyjnej i łatwą integracją.
Czym jest serwer systemu plików MCP od Mark3Labs
Serwer systemu plików MCP od Mark3Labs to otwartoźródłowy serwer zaimplementowany w Go, który zapewnia bezpieczny, oparty na protokole dostęp do lokalnych systemów plików dla aplikacji LLM i agentów AI. Dzięki implementacji Model Context Protocol (MCP) serwer ten pozwala narzędziom zewnętrznym i modelom AI na interakcję ze strukturą plików i katalogów hosta w kontrolowany i bezpieczny sposób. Oferuje szczegółową kontrolę dostępu, solidną walidację ścieżek w celu zapobiegania nieautoryzowanemu dostępowi oraz obsługuje operacje takie jak odczyt, zapis, wyszukiwanie, kopiowanie, przenoszenie i usuwanie plików oraz katalogów. Serwer został zaprojektowany do łatwej integracji — zarówno jako samodzielna usługa, jak i biblioteka w Go, a także posiada wsparcie dla Dockera umożliwiające elastyczne wdrożenia. Funkcje bezpieczeństwa obejmują rozwiązywanie symlinków, wykrywanie typu MIME oraz obsługę zarówno danych tekstowych, jak i binarnych, zapewniając, że dostęp mają tylko dozwolone katalogi, a ataki typu directory traversal są ograniczone. Czyni go to idealnym rozwiązaniem dla programistów i organizacji, które chcą bezpiecznie i wydajnie połączyć systemy AI z lokalnymi lub zdalnymi systemami plików.
Możliwości
Co możemy zrobić z serwerem systemu plików MCP
Dzięki serwerowi systemu plików MCP użytkownicy mogą bezpiecznie wykonywać szeroki zakres operacji na plikach i katalogach przez spójną warstwę protokołu. Pozwala to na płynną integrację dostępu do systemu plików w aplikacjach opartych na LLM i przepływach pracy AI, wszystko z silnymi kontrolami bezpieczeństwa.
- Odczyt plików
- Odczyt zawartości pojedynczych lub wielu plików z dozwolonych katalogów.
- Zapis i modyfikacja plików
- Tworzenie nowych plików, nadpisywanie istniejących lub aktualizacja treści w plikach przy użyciu dopasowania ciągów lub wyrażeń regularnych.
- Kopiowanie, przenoszenie i usuwanie
- Kopiowanie, przenoszenie/zmiana nazwy lub usuwanie plików i katalogów w sposób bezpieczny, w tym operacje rekurencyjne.
- Zarządzanie katalogami
- Listowanie zawartości katalogów, tworzenie nowych katalogów i generowanie widoków hierarchicznych (tree) struktur katalogów.
- Wyszukiwanie i metadane
- Wyszukiwanie plików i katalogów według wzorca, wyszukiwanie w zawartości plików oraz pobieranie szczegółowych metadanych o plikach i katalogach.

Jak agenci AI korzystają z serwera systemu plików MCP
Agenci AI mogą korzystać z serwera systemu plików MCP, aby w bezpieczny i uporządkowany sposób współpracować z lokalnym systemem plików. Umożliwia to agentom odczyt, zapis, wyszukiwanie i organizowanie plików jako element ich zautomatyzowanych przepływów pracy, ułatwiając takie zadania jak automatyczne przetwarzanie dokumentów, dynamiczne zarządzanie plikami czy ekstrakcja danych. Dzięki solidnej kontroli dostępu i szerokiemu wsparciu operacyjnemu serwer umożliwia AI bezpieczne działanie w określonych granicach, minimalizując ryzyko przy jednoczesnym zwiększaniu możliwości automatyzacji.